Replaces the detached `setsid nohup … nsenter …` launch, which had no restart policy, no boot persistence and no supervisor-visible logs. Staging units are installed and proven; production units are TEMPLATES and are not installed. Three decisions, each measured rather than assumed: * `Wants=`, not `Requires=`, from host to Core. With `Requires`, stopping Core stopped the host AND a later Core start did not bring it back -- a routine Core restart would leave the client with no server. With `Wants` the host survives a Core outage, answers 503 core_unavailable, never falls back to Python, and resumes the moment Core returns with no intervention. Both halves tested. * Readiness is a bounded ExecStartPre TCP gate, because ordering proves nothing about readiness and Type=exec only proves the binary exec'd. Core binds its listener after migrations and content load, so "port open" is a real signal. The gate FAILS rather than blocking: a host that waits forever looks healthy while serving nobody. * The netns is resolved by container NAME every start. The container is restart=unless-stopped and its netns inode CHANGES on restart (measured: 4026539938 -> 4026540033), so a hardcoded pid is wrong by construction and anything left in the old namespace serves nobody. Proven equivalent to today's nsenter against a scratch container, never production's namespace. `systemd-analyze verify` caught two real defects before deployment: StartLimitIntervalSec/StartLimitBurst sat in [Service], where systemd 252 silently ignores them, so the crash-loop ceiling was not taking effect; and a Documentation URL containing %20 parsed as a specifier. Both fixed and the effective properties re-confirmed from the running units. Staging evidence: Core-first ordering, host refused when Core is absent or merely not listening, outage survival, automatic recovery, restart, graceful stop with no strays, boot simulated via multi-user.target, 3x SIGKILL contained at ~5s spacing, journald logs, and economy state byte-identical throughout (integrity ok, fk 0).
